I can confirm that F-104's were at Luke AFB and used to train German Pilots. They came in while my father was stationed there in the early 60's. I became familar with their distinctive whine at the old Hamilton AFB north of San Francisco when the USAF started getting them back in the mid to late 50's. (OK, so I am old). As a side note, they used to sight in the guns on the Air Forces F-100's and the German F-104's at any time day or night at Luke. You could sure tell the difference when they fired the F-104's Gatling Gun vs the F-100's Canons.
